## Ticket: Config drift on Gatefinch chip readers

During prep for the Ostbury marathon we found the trackside Gatefinch readers at mats 3 and 7 running different read-window and antenna-gain settings than the fleet baseline. The drift appears to date from ad-hoc tuning at the spring relay event; changes were never written back to the provisioning repo.

Proposal: reflash all readers from baseline before race day and lock local edits. For the record, the baseline is.

service settings:
[silwyn]
host = silwyn.crelvogrid.internal
user = silwyn_svc
database = silwyn_prod

Runbook fragment: Birchline API v5 release

Pagination changes in v5: cursor tokens replace page offsets on all public endpoints. Old offset params return 410 after the flag flip. Release manager must flip `pagination_v5` only after the gateway cache is purged; otherwise mixed token formats cause 500s. Smoke test: walk the /orders listing end-to-end with cursors before announcing. The release artifact must be re-signed after the gateway config change; sign with the key below.

signing key of bagap-yawep = bky13_TbfT6ZMUoGJo2

Facilities Ticket — Cleaning Crew Access, Brindle Annex

For new starters handling evening lock-up: the Sorano Cleaning crew arrives nightly at 21:30 via the annex side door. Check their rota sheet, note arrival in the log, and ensure the storeroom is relocked afterward. To let them through the side door, enter the access code below.

badge for yaweg-hafog: bdg-GX-6

Handover: Pedalflow rebalancing tool. Marit is taking over from Dmitri as of this week. The truck-routing solver now reads dock occupancy from the Kestrelview feed every 10 minutes; the old hourly snapshot path is deprecated but still deployed in the Varnholm region. Known issue: negative capacity values when a station is mid-maintenance. Dmitri documented the workaround and the cutover checklist on the internal page here.

dashboard of bafof-hafog = https://confluence.lumiclabs.internal/display/browse/display/6a09a20a